A   PSA nitrogen gas plant   produces high-purity nitrogen from compressed air. It works by passing air through an adsorbent material that captures oxygen and other gases, leaving pure nitrogen. These plants are efficient, reliable, and used in industries like pharmaceuticals and electronics for their low energy consumption and on-site production capability. PSA (Pressure Swing Adsorption) nitrogen gas plants  play a crucial role in various medical applications, primarily due to the high purity and reliability of the nitrogen they produce. Here are some of the key medical uses: Medical Device Manufacturing : Nitrogen is commonly used in the manufacturing process of medical devices such as catheters, stents, and surgical instruments. PSA nitrogen gas plants provide a consistent and high-purity nitrogen supply necessary for the production of these critical medical tools. Understanding PSA Nitrogen Gas Plants PSA nitrogen gas plants are engineered systems designed for the separation of nitrogen from compressed air using the principle of adsorption. Unlike traditional methods like cryogenic distillation, which require bulky equipment and extensive energy consumption, PSA plants offer a compact and energy-efficient solution for on-site nitrogen generation.
